I'm hoping someone can offer advice on problems that I'm experiencing with
Outlook 2003 toolbar buttons.

Toolbar buttons usually work fine when I first open Outlook, but after I use
a particular button once, it no longer works. For example, I can create a
task, then assign the task. the next time I create a task, the assign
button no longer works. I have to re-boot outlook to get the button to work
again - then it only works once, etc, etc.

This is also true of many other (but not all ) Outlook buttons, like "Save
and Close", "Recurrence", and others. One more thing, the menu command
equivalents of the buttons exhibit the same behaviour.

Running clean install of Office OL 2003 on fresh build of Win XP Pro, all OS
and Office Service packs and updates installed.

Try closing Outlook and then rename outcmd.dat to .old. This file controls
how toolbars are displayed - it sounds like you have a corrupt outcmd.dat
file. If this does not fix it, please post back.
